The Growth Hormone Releasing Peptide, in Plain Words
Many adults experience a natural decline in their body’s production of vital hormones as they age. This shift can manifest in various ways, from reduced energy levels and impaired sleep patterns to less efficient recovery from physical exertion. Understanding the science behind these changes is the first step toward exploring effective solutions.
At the core of healthy aging support is the intricate hormonal balance your body maintains. One key player is growth hormone (GH), produced by the pituitary gland. GH influences metabolism, cell repair, and muscle growth. Over time, the pulsatile release of GH diminishes, which can contribute to the symptoms often associated with aging.
This is where a specific type of compounded prescription, a GHRH analog, enters the conversation. This synthetic peptide mimics the body’s natural growth hormone-releasing hormone (GHRH). By stimulating the pituitary gland, it encourages a more youthful and robust pulsatile release of GH. This can potentially help mitigate some of the effects of declining GH levels.
Think of it as helping your body tap into its own youthful potential. The goal isn’t to artificially boost hormone levels beyond a natural range, but rather to restore a more optimal pulsatile secretion pattern. This approach focuses on supporting the body’s intrinsic regulatory mechanisms for a more natural feeling of rejuvenation and vitality.
How a Real Prescription is Obtained From Arizona
Obtaining a prescription for this specialized therapy involves a clear, regulated process designed for your safety and well-being. It begins with a thorough medical evaluation conducted by a licensed US clinician. This clinician operates within the regulatory framework of Arizona, ensuring all protocols adhere to state and federal guidelines.
You start by completing an asynchronous online intake form. This comprehensive questionnaire gathers essential details about your medical history, current health status, and lifestyle. You can complete this from the comfort of your home, fitting it into your schedule without the need for immediate appointments or travel. This initial step allows the clinician to gain a foundational understanding of your individual health profile.
Following the intake, you will schedule a telehealth consultation with the licensed clinician. During this video or phone appointment, you discuss your health goals, concerns, and the information provided in your intake. The clinician assesses your medical necessity for the therapy. This consultation is crucial for ensuring the treatment is appropriate and safe for you.
If deemed medically necessary and appropriate, the clinician will issue a prescription for the compounded sermorelin acetate. It’s important to understand that compounded medications like this are dispensed by licensed compounding pharmacies under sections 503A and 503B of the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act. This process ensures quality and customization but is distinct from separate FDA approval for the drug itself. Your prescription will be sent electronically to a partner compounding pharmacy.
The pharmacy then prepares your personalized prescription. They carefully package the medication, often including necessary supplies for administration like syringes and alcohol swabs. This entire process is streamlined to provide you with convenient access to a regulated therapeutic option. Your prescription is only issued after a direct medical consultation with a qualified practitioner.
